企业号介绍

全部
  • 全部
  • 产品
  • 方案
  • 文章
  • 资料
  • 企业

北汇信息POLELINK

北汇信息始终专注于汽车电子领域的新技术和新产品,秉承“价值创造、共享成功”理念,为整车厂和零部件企业提供完整的研发、测试解决方案。

382 内容数 34w+ 浏览量 38 粉丝

Klocwork——支持DevOps和功能安全/信息安全的静态代码分析器

型号: Klocwork

--- 产品详情 ---

 

Klocwork是一款现代、灵活的静态代码分析器,适用于C、C++、C#、Java、JavaScript、Python和Kotlin的静态检测,可以识别软件中的潜在缺陷,在开发最前期保证代码的安全性和可靠性,帮助软件遵循相应的编码规范。

Klocwork专为企业级DevOps/DevSecOps构建,可拓展到任何规模的项目检测,尤其适用于大型复杂开发环境,可实现不同编译环境的自由切换;支持增量分析;提供Web端管理平台,为项目协作提供极大便利;提供可定制化报告,适应不同项目要求。

Klocwork的主要功能特性:

  • 基于SAST(静态应用程序安全测试)查找安全漏洞

Klocwork具有内置的检查程序,在DevOps(DevSecOps)流程中自动检查源代码中数百个潜在的安全漏洞,确定必须修复的缺陷,并在Validate端给出详细的指导,帮助开发人员高效修复源码中存在的问题,提高代码的安全性、可靠性和合规性。

  • 支持DevOps

Klocwork工具的设计以持续集成和持续交付为首要思想,这使得将静态代码分析作为CI/CD的一部分变得容易,从而使开发人员能够更早、更频繁地发现代码缺陷。

增量分析:通过Klocwork Server的系统上下文数据,在整个系统已经分析完成后,可以仅分析已更改的文件,提供差异分析结果。这种方式可以尽可能减少分析耗时。

易于自动化:Klocwork工具有强大的命令行界面,我们可以基于命令行实现任何静态分析操作,这为实现测试流程自动化提供了极大便利。

容器化构建:Klocwork可以在容器化和云构建的系统中运行,为能够使用内部云或者外部云服务进行代码静态分析提供最大限度的灵活性和机会。

  • 支持行业标准要求的编码规范

Klocwork支持的行业标准:IEC 61508、ISO 26262、EN 50128、DO-178B/C、 IEC 62304、FDA。在相关标准下涉及到的编码规范有MISRA、AUTOSAR、CERT、CWE、OWASP、DISA STIG、PCI DSS、C Secure、JSF AV C++、NASA,针对以上编码规则,Klocwork提供一站式支持,并且您可以根据项目要求定制化编码规范,这使得通过静态分析自动化遵循编码规范变得非常简单。

同时,Klocwork支持通过Klocwork Checker Studio定制化检查规则。开发/测试工程师可以借助Klocwork Abstract Syntax Tree (KAST)抽象语法树快速轻松地创建定制的安全检查,契合不同项目的静态分析要求。

  • 提供网页端集中式分析与管理平台——Klocwork Validate

Klocwork Validate集中执行深度代码静态分析,并提供高度可定制的管理平台,使开发人员、主管和其他项目相关人员能够:

  • 定义全局或特定项目的 QA 、安全目标以及规则配置。
  • 控制访问权限和审批流程。
  • 查看趋势图和度量数据,掌握项目质量和趋势。
  • 生成合规性和安全性报告,支持报告的高度定制化。
  • 根据严重程度、位置和生命周期确定缺陷的优先级。
  • 使用 Smart Rank帮助开发人员根据缺陷可能性确定修复的优先级,结合问题严重性(Critical/Error/Warning…),提供整体漏洞风险评分。
  • 针对诊断问题提供详细的修改说明。
  • 区分新问题与遗留代码问题
  • 将积压问题推送到变更控制系统。
  • 将Helix QAC调查结果导入并集成到Klocwork SAC,实现在单个仪表板中查看和管理合并的分析结果。
  • 支持的IDEs 
  • Supported C/C++ IDEs:CLion、Eclipse、Wind River Workbench、QNX Momentics、Microsoft Visual Studio、Visual Studio Code
  • Supported C# IDEs:Microsoft Visual Studio、Visual Studio Code
  • Supported Java IDEs:Android Studio、Eclipse、IBM Rational Application Developer for WebSphere、JetBrains IntelliJ IDEA、Visual Studio Code
  • Supported JavaScript/Kotlin/Python IDEs:Visual Studio Code
  • 支持的编译器

无需用户配置,Klocwork为数百个编译器和交叉编译器提供开箱即用的支持。

 

  • 支持的操作系统
  • Amazon Linux 2、CentOS、Debian、Fedora、Oracle Linux、OpenSUSE、SUSE Enterprise、Red Hat Enterprise Linux、Ubuntu
  • Windows 8.1、Windows 10 versions 1809 to 21H2、Windows Server 2012 to R2、Windows Server 2016、Windows Server 2019

资质认证

Klocwork通过了ISO、IEC、EN的TÜV-SÜD合规认证,可用于信息安全、功能安全相关软件的开发测试。针对IEC 61508(工业标准)可达SIL4, ISO 26262(汽车功能安全)可达ASIL D, EN 50128(铁路交通)可满足SW-SIL4等级要求, IEC 62304(医疗)Software Safety Class C)标准,帮助客户用更少的时间完成产品认证。

图 1 资质认证证书

关于原厂:

Perforce是一家DevOps解决方案提供商,其产品覆盖版本控制软件、应用程序生命周期管理平台、敏捷规划软件以及用于静态代码分析的Klockwork等。Perforce有40,000多个客户,涵盖从热门游戏厂商、半导体公司到著名互联网公司、汽车行业、银行及金融公司等各行各业。在静态分析领域,它有30多年软件开发和测试经验,是MISRA编码委员会和AUTOSAR组织的会员,参与编写编码规范,是静态分析领域公认的行业领导和先驱。

客户列表(部分)

技术支持

由通过Klocwork资质认证的专业技术团队提供技术支持。

技术咨询

根据您的行业及项目需求,为您提供最佳静态测试解决方案(Klocwork、Helix QAC),助力提升测试效率。

产品试用

联系北汇信息,根据您项目需要提供试用许可,帮助您部署软件及解决应用问题。

 

为你推荐

  • 知识分享 | 轻松实现优质建模2024-09-12 08:08

    知识分享在知识分享栏目中,我们会定期与读者分享来自MES模赛思的基于模型的软件开发相关Know-How干货,关注公众号,随时掌握基于模型的软件设计的技术知识。轻松实现优质建模前言在基于模型的开发(MBD)领域,模型的质量对于最终产品的成功至关重要。通过阅读本文,您可了解如何提升模型质量,并在整个开发过程中确保模型的一致性和质量。什么是更好的建模?更好的建模,
    133浏览量
  • TSN时间敏感网络技术入门级解决方案TSN BasicSolution2024-09-12 08:08

    翻译|Br1anQ小编|不吃猪头肉简介作为全球专业的TSN网络分析及测量解决方案提供商,TSNSystems公司的主打产品TSNCoreSolution是专为时间关键型网络设计的全面解决方案,提供了一个完整的生态系统,旨在满足区域架构开发和验证的需求与挑战。它结合了硬件(如TSNBox)和软件(如TSNTools)组件,为全球OEM厂商和一级供应商提供了应对
    827浏览量
  • 邀请函 | Vector中国汽车网络安全技术日2024-09-05 08:05

    在电动化之后,智能化和网联化逐渐成为汽车新四化发展主流,随着自动驾驶、大数据、AI等技术的应用,汽车变得愈发开放与互联,但与此同时遭受安全攻击的风险也在呈指数级增长。为此,包括汽车整车信息安全技术要求(GB44495-2024)在内,全球各主要汽车市场国家和地区均已经或即将颁布相关强制法规,以督促行业尽快建立网络安全防范机制。网络安全涵盖汽车开发、生产、售后
    94浏览量
  • IPv6协议—互联网通信协议第六版2024-09-05 08:05

    IPv6是互联网升级演进的必然趋势、网络技术创新的重要方向、网络强国建设的基础支撑。近些年,随着我国大力推动IPv6规模部署和应用,目前中国的IPv6渗透率已超过70%。对于车载以太网来说,目前IPv4是车载IP通信的主流协议,但随着车辆的智能化、网联化程度不断提高,IPv6协议应用在车载以太网是一种未来趋势。那IPv6是什么呢,它包含哪些内容呢,带着这些疑
    301浏览量
  • 深入了解基于CANoe的VIO系统应用2024-09-01 16:21

    VIO System是Vector推出的一款适用于前期单板级测试使用的硬件系统,不仅可以进行总线通讯测试,也可以同时进行I/O信号测试,可以让工程师在ECU或者传感器开发前期就发现问题,能够尽早排查解决,极大降低了人力物力开发成本。
    2523浏览量
  • 自动驾驶实车功能测试必备:高精度光学测量工具MXoptiCal,分分钟搞定实车测试数据对标2024-08-30 12:49

    概述在实车ADAS/AD功能测试时,工程师需要在车上安装更高精度的传感器来对车辆的参照物距离进行准确测量,从而判断ADAS/AD功能实现的准确性,因此也需要车上准确的对照点位置。MXoptiCal是由德国MdynamiX公司开发的一款高精度光学测量工具,旨在实现简便且重复性高的测量,并且精准可靠。该工具通过自动化和高效的测试过程,为汽车ADAS/AD功能测试
    939浏览量
  • 电动汽车电池热失控研究2024-08-30 12:49

    电动汽车动力电池的热力学研究一直是电池系统开发的关键部分。随着动力电池设计需要满足更高的功率和容量要求,对高压电池内部热传导的测量变得尤为重要。新型HVDTemp数字温度测量系统可利用数百个精确定位的数字传感器来研究电池热点结晶区域,这些区域代表着热失控的潜在危险。高压温度测量01背景在对动力电池进行分析和测试时,需要特别注意热失控可能带来的潜在危险。如果动
  • 整车低压电源模式介绍2024-08-30 12:49

    在日新月异的汽车行业中,有老牌车企不断推出新品牌,也出现了许多新势力车企。在这种市场环境下,各个车型的功能及其实现方式会存在许多的差异。本篇文章主要给大家介绍的是低压电源模式,希望能对大家有所帮助。电源模式概述整车低压电源模式是指整车上电(这里的上电指的是蓄电池连接)状态下,发动机未启动(发动机车型)或者动力电池没有上高压(插电式混动车型、增程混动车型或者纯
  • TSN时间敏感网络技术入门级解决方案TSN BasicSolution2024-08-16 08:58

    随着TSN技术获得越来越多的关注和广泛应用,TSN Systems公司推出了一款入门级的解决方案TSN BasicSolution,通过简化的方式为用户提供关键功能,基于硬件与软件的无缝集成,帮助您提升生产力,更快实现目标并且有效应对复杂的任务和分析需求。
    1462浏览量
  • 嵌入式系统中工业4.0网络安全2024-08-12 21:45

    C和C++在嵌入式系统中占主导地位。多年来,实施工业4.0和物联网的组织已经认识到所有代码中的信息安全性的重要性,特别是对于嵌入式设备中的C和C++,其中损失的成本可能不仅仅是财务方面。建立并不断改进编码标准就是为了帮助提高软件的安全性、可移植性、可靠性和可维护性的水平。静态分析除了在源代码中搜索缺陷和漏洞外,还可以应用于编码标准中规定的规则和建议。这对于需
  • TSN和DDS测试解决方案2024-05-10 09:29

    北汇信息提供的TSN/DDS测试系统,测试工具链多样化:提供Vector、TSN Systems、Spirent、臻融科技全套测试解决方案,满足不同测试场景下的实际需求。
    250浏览量
  • 汽车智能座舱域功能测试2024-05-10 09:20

    北汇信息推出座舱域功能测试解决方案,支持在实验室环境以及实车环境下完成座舱域功能测试,不仅可以确保产品质量、提升用户体验、保障行车安全,也能降低维护成本、加速产品上市、满足法规要求、推动技术创新等。
    1.8k浏览量
  • 车载T-Box逻辑功能测试方案2024-04-26 11:19

    北汇信息基于对客户需求规范、行业法规及自身测试经验Know-How,为客户提供完整和专业的T-Box逻辑功能测试解决方案。支持在实验室环境及实车环境下完成T-Box上层逻辑功能测试及实车数据分析测试,可以极大地提升T-Box的可靠性和稳定性。
  • 汽车OTA通道和压力测试方案2024-04-25 09:16

    北汇信息基于对客户需求规范、行业法规及自身测试经验Know-How,为汽车客户提供完整和专业的汽车OTA通道测试和压力测试解决方案,包括测试系统开发、测试规范开发、测试脚本实现及测试实施的全流程服务。
    1.2k浏览量
  • TSN网络设计与验证咨询服务2022-09-24 16:59

    TSN通信技术逐步走进汽车行业的视野,目前国内外OEM已积极展开TSN技术预研与储备工作。伴随TSN车规级通信芯片成熟度的提升,TSN必将成为IVN以太网主干网的核心基础技术之一。北汇信息多年来一直致力于TSN设计与验证的实践工作,积累了丰富的TSN项目经验。其间,参与多个国内TSN项目,拥有完整的TSN设计、仿真、原型搭建的开发经验,同时为客户提供齐备的TSN测试工具链与验证方法。
    TSN
    554浏览量
  • 北汇信息MES成功案例及合作伙伴2022-07-19 18:59

    MES成功案例上海汽车制动系统有限公司(SABS)上海汽车制动系统有限公司(简称SABS)是德国大陆公司与上海汽车工业(集团)总公司双方共同投资组建的企业。公司主要产品为ABS防抱死制动系统、制动钳、助力器、传感器、制动软管等。其生产涉及机加、电镀、装配等三种模式。本着“统一规划、分步实施”的原则,SABS逐年分步进行了MES系统建设。系统覆盖了机加、电镀、装配车间。包含:设备集成、SAP集成、计
    622浏览量
  • 注塑MES解决方案2022-07-19 18:42

    通过MES系统建设,可以对生产计划、执行过程、生产质量、资源等进行全面的数字化管控,打破工厂信息孤岛的现状,通过整合工厂数据,实现数据集中管控与共享,为生产制造经营信息提炼提供数据基础。
    610浏览量
  • 军工航空航天MES解决方案2022-07-19 18:30

    军工航空航天MES解决方案:过建立以MES为核心的生产管理系统,与相关信息系统的集成,形成完整的生产信息化管理平台,实现信息化建设的目标。
    941浏览量
  • 汽车行业MES解决方案2022-07-19 18:19

    针对汽车生产制造行业对制造管理系统的管理需求,以及北汇信息在汽车行业多年的MES实施经验,北信息提供一套成熟的生产信息化管理系统(MES)为生产管理者及企业管理者提供真实、完整、多视角的评估报告,有效支持各级管理决策。
    796浏览量
  • 底盘系统硬件在环(HiL)测试解决方案2022-07-19 17:44

    北汇信息为OEM和零部件企业提供众多成熟的底盘系统解决方案,包括电动助力转向系统EPS HiL测试方案,制动系统HiL测试方案等。